We’re seeking a future team member for the role of Senior Vice President to join our Counterparty Credit Risk team. This role is be located New York, NY in a Hybrid work environment.

About the team:

Counterparty Credit Risk (“CCR”) is a 2nd Line-of-Defense function within Credit Risk that will enhance oversight and controls over CCR metrics. The Senior Vice President will be responsible for counterparty credit risk management and reporting, including stress testing development and review, as well as providing leadership for governance functions, presenting to key oversight committees, and acting as a regulatory liaison.

In this role, you’ll make an impact in the following ways: 

  • Work with senior management roles to ensure that the appropriate counterparty credit risk and collateral management policies, methods, standards, processes, and training are developed, applied and understood by impacted stakeholders. Applies extensive knowledge of market or liquidity risk analysis, monitoring processes and in-depth knowledge of the financial industry, technology and the requirements of regulatory bodies in support of managing and analyzing risk. Recognized throughout the Risk organization and the businesses as the counterparty credit and collateral risk point of contact and subject matter expert.
  • Produces (and may deliver) risk presentations to senior management and regulators. Anticipates and addresses Audit and regulatory concerns regarding the counterparty credit risk framework, governance, and operations. In partnership with management, establishes the counterparty credit risk strategy for the business area(s) and is accountable for ensuring the implementation of that strategy, including the appropriate analysis, review and approval of collateral for businesses.
  • Manage all activities related to the development and production of counterparty credit risk platforms and metrics. Plans and implements the risk policies and procedures and internal controls across multiple businesses and locations.
  • Discuss and negotiate technical requirements and multi-departmental solutions, designs and implements innovative, efficient, auditable processes, and documents results for all levels of management.
  • Design solutions for counterparty credit risk management that are aligned with evolving regulatory requirements, audit and compliance scrutiny and industry best practices.
  • Responsibilities are primarily specialized to address the counterparty credit risk management needs for major global initiatives, large areas of the business, specific legal entities, or material events.  

To be successful in this role, we’re seeking the following: 

  • Bachelor’s Degree or the equivalent combination of education and experience is required. Masters degree preferred. 
  • Market Risk: Ability to analyze and report on counterparty credit risk metrics and to develop and analyze the impact of internal and regulatory stress tests
  • 10-12 years of experience in market or credit liquidity risk preferred. Experience in financial services is strongly preferred. Background in math, statistics, finance, economics, risk management, operations research, or a similar field is preferred.
